Disney Channel Alum Skai Jackson Welcomes Her First Child
Skai Jackson is officially a mom!
The Disney Channel alum, known for her roles in Jessie and Big Boss, announced the arrival of her first child on January 26. Sharing the exciting news with her fans, Jackson posted a heartwarming photo of her holding her newborn’s hands, simply captioned “Kasai.” The pair donned cozy, matching green pajamas. Kasai, an element-inspired name of Japanese origin traditionally means “fire.”
From Keke Palmer to Holly Peete, several friends, fans and fellow actors rushed to send their love and congratulate the new mom in the comments. “Omg Congratulations on this whole new mommy chapter of your life! You are going to be an amazing mom,” wrote internet personality Monique Carrillo. Jackson’s mom, Kiya Cole, also shared her excitement, commenting, “My little Kasai is the cutest.”
Jackson first revealed her pregnancy on November 12. “I’m thrilled to begin this new chapter in my life — embracing motherhood and diving into new acting projects. My heart is so full!” Jackson told People.
Jackson is worked throughout her pregnancy, traveling to promote her new movie The Man in The White Van. Her dedication and drive are inspired by her mother, who was also an actress and raised Jackson as a single mom. "[My mom] always taught me to stand up for myself, stand up for what I believe in and fight for what is right,” she previously told People. “I thank her for that because without her, I probably wouldn’t have a lot of the confidence that I do now.”
